Block 147,906
Block Hash
29ccdab2b023835fcd8fb4e7433818aa4ef7c3651fcd826c37563ecb1f
a8d6aa
Previous Block Hash
04c2bb43ea53cf05702cf8afbdd1df8163197249ab1da8fd23364ac688 594041
Mined
Transactions
2
Difficulty
3.85 M
Size
974 bytes
Transactions (2)
1 input, 1 output
250,000.000008
PEPE
6 inputs, 2 outputs
1,250,000.010006
PEPE